In partnership with the National Health Service (NHS), Insight is pleased to introduce a rigorously developed re-feeding protocol aimed at pediatric patients admitted to wards due to sensory restrictive eating disorders, including Autism and ARFID (Avoidant/Restrictive Food Intake Disorder). This resource provides a standardized approach to emergency re-feeding, incorporating evidence-based risk assessments and monitoring. Adherence to this plan aims to optimize patient safety while navigating the complexities of emergency re-feeding for these specific conditions.

The plan outlines:

  • The critical risk assessments necessary for safe re-feeding
  • Standardized initial caloric intake parameters, adapted for high-risk conditions
  • Biochemical markers to be closely monitored
  • Sensory-specific considerations for nutrient supplementation and meal presentation

While this resource serves as a valuable tool for emergency admissions, it is designed to be a transitional measure until an individualized dietitian-devised meal plan can be implemented.
